none
Problema ao retornar um List<> RRS feed

  • Pergunta

  • Boa tarde.

    Estou desenvolvendo um serviço em WCF e estou com um problema ao retornar um List<> do objeto Content.

    [OperationContract]
    OperationResult<List<Content>> GetHighlightedContent(int idContentType);
    
    [OperationContract]
    OperationResult<Content> GetByIdContent(int idContent);

    O serviço GetById (que retorna somente um objeto) funciona perfeitamente, mas quando tento retornar uma lista dele (GetHighlightedContent) aparece o seguinte erro:

    This operation is not supported in wcf test client because it uses type

    Podem me ajudar?

    Vlw!


    Danilo Oliveira www.coffeeandcodes.com.br

    quarta-feira, 29 de abril de 2015 18:36

Todas as Respostas

  • Colega imagine que sua classe tenha dois atributos string nome e endereco, e um método de chamada para instanciar sua classe recebendo estes dois atributos

    segue o código

    List<MinhaClasse> MinhaLista = new List<MinhaClasse>();
        MinhaLista.Add(new MinhaClasse("Carlos","Rua Dez, 25"));
        MinhaLista.Add(new MinhaClasse("Antonio", "Rua Zeca, 27"));
        MinhaLista.Add(new MinhaClasse("Jose", "Rua Joaqui, 30"));
    
        foreach (MinhaClasse item in MinhaLista)
        {
             MessageBox.Show("Nome:"+item.Nome+" Endereco: "+item.Endereco);
        }

    o forech carrega cada item de MinhaLista no campo item = MinhaClasse entendeu ?


    Se a resposta contribuiu com seu aprendizado por favor marque como Útil
    Se solucionou seu problema por favor marque como Resposta
    Atenção, se seu problema foi resolvido não deixe o post aberto 

    Visite : www.codigoexpresso.com.br


    sexta-feira, 15 de julho de 2016 22:57